In the plastics industry, Titanium Dioxide is not only responsible for providing whiteness and opacity but also plays a crucial role in determining product durability and processing stability. Among various titanium dioxide products, Rutile Titanium Dioxide R299+ stands out due to its optimized surface treatment technology and has become a preferred choice for many manufacturers of high-end plastic products.
First, R299+ demonstrates excellent dispersion during plastic extrusion and injection molding. Its particles are evenly distributed throughout the plastic matrix, effectively reducing agglomeration and preventing surface defects such as black spots and color inconsistencies. This uniformity is particularly critical for products like PVC profiles, high-end appliance housings, and packaging materials, where surface quality is essential. Many manufacturers using R299+ report lower defect rates and improved visual and structural quality of the final product.

In addition to dispersion, gloss performance is another advantage of R299+. Due to its uniform particle size, plastic surfaces appear smoother and reflect light more evenly, enhancing the overall appearance. This is especially important for decorative plastic components and consumer electronics housings, where visual quality can directly impact market competitiveness. Many high-end PVC window and door profiles, as well as appliance casings, rely on R299+ to ensure consistent surface gloss and overall aesthetic appeal.
Weather resistance is also a key feature of R299+. With advanced surface coating technology, R299+ offers improved UV stability. In outdoor applications such as PVC pipes, window profiles, and agricultural films, it helps slow down material aging and maintain long-term color consistency. For outdoor products, maintaining stable color and performance under exposure to sunlight, rain, and temperature fluctuations is a critical requirement, and R299+ delivers on this front.
Furthermore, R299+ performs very well in plastic masterbatch production by providing stable processing flow characteristics. Consistent processing behavior not only enhances production efficiency but also reduces equipment wear, ultimately lowering overall manufacturing costs. For large-scale production of high-performance PVC and engineering plastics, stable flow properties mean fewer downtime interruptions and higher yield rates.
